Yemeni MP Slams Iran’s Lies: “Support for Houthis Is a Fact, Not an Accusation”

During the Organization of Islamic Cooperation Parliamentary Union conference in Jakarta, Yemeni MP and head of the Islah Party parliamentary bloc, Abdulrazzaq Al-Hajri, forcefully rejected the Iranian delegate’s claim that “most Yemenis support the Houthi militia.”

Al-Hajri emphasized that all Yemenis oppose the Houthis, stating, “Only Iran stands with them.” He accused Iran of fueling the conflict by providing the militia with weapons and funding, and said this support is a documented reality known to the world.

Highlighting Houthi crimes, Al-Hajri questioned, “How can those who kill their own people, destroy homes, mosques, and schools, and violate the dignity of women claim to defend the dignity of Palestinians?”

He listed numerous violations committed by the Houthis, including forced displacement, child soldier recruitment, and looting of state institutions. Al-Hajri stressed that the war is not merely political, but a battle to protect the republic and national identity.

He called on Islamic nations to increase their support for Yemen’s legitimate government and take a firm stance against Iranian-backed militias that threaten regional stability.
